The Role

We are looking for a Software QA Engineer to join our Bluefield DPU testing team. This position will be part of the QA group which enables NVIDIA products meet the industry leading benchmarks of efficiency and quality. The ideal candidate will engage in testing of DPU SW and DOCA SDK industry-leading features, be able to learn new features, execute manual and automated tests, and engage in automation development.

What you'll be doing:

  • Review arch design and requirements for new features introduced in the DPU software and DOCA SDK

  • Design, develop, and execute tests for the new features, as part of DPU software GA releases or update releases

  • Report bugs found during execution, assist with reproduction and debugs to understand root cause, verify bug fixes provided by R&D team, raise if not fixed

  • Automate newly added tests in the existing automation framework, add new capabilities and features to the framework

  • Develop/Enhance Tools, applications, or processes to improve the quality and test efficiency

 

What we need to see:

  • B.A. / B.Sc. in Computer Science or Electrical Engineering

  • 1-3 years of proven experience as a Software QA Engineer

  • Basic knowledge of Networking

  • Hands-on experience with Linux

  • Background with scripting languages (Python/Bash/Perl)

  • Independent, responsible worker, able to plan and execute

  • Clear verbal and written communication, proficient written and spoken English

 

Ways to stand out from the crowd:

  • Experience in Networking, test design and automation

  • Proven programming experience in Python

  • Familiarity with CUDA SDK

  • Experience with QA of SoCs with embedded processors

  • Proven experience with automation infrastructure design and plan

What We Do

NVIDIA’s invention of the GPU in 1999 sparked the growth of the PC gaming market, redefined modern computer graphics, and revolutionized parallel computing. More recently, GPU deep learning ignited modern AI — the next era of computing — with the GPU acting as the brain of computers, robots, and self-driving cars that can perceive and understand the world. Today, NVIDIA is increasingly known as “the AI computing company.”
